About Marisol Juan‐Borrás

Marisol Juan‐Borrás is a scholar working on Insect Science, Biochemistry and Food Science, having authored 29 papers that have together received 954 indexed citations. Recurring topics across this work include Bee Products Chemical Analysis (19 papers), Insect and Pesticide Research (16 papers) and Essential Oils and Antimicrobial Activity (10 papers). The work is most often cited by research in Insect Science (689 citations), Biochemistry (245 citations) and Food Science (485 citations). Marisol Juan‐Borrás has collaborated with scholars based in Spain, Czechia and Mozambique. Frequent co-authors include Isabel Escriche, Eva Doménech, P. Fito, Ana Heredia, Andrea Conchado Peiró, Ana Andrés, Ángela Periche, Antonio Arnau, Yolanda Jiménez and A. Montoya. Their work appears in journals such as Food Chemistry, Food Research International and Journal of Food Science.
